Homes in Broadview Park built before 1980 are working with plumbing systems that were never designed to last indefinitely. Galvanized steel pipes corrode from the inside over decades, reducing flow before they fail visibly. Cast iron drain lines crack and shift as ground settles. Water heaters installed in the early 2000s are past their expected service life. Frequent Plumbing Issues in Broadview Park, FL
- Burst and leaking pipes โ Florida's subtropical heat, hurricane season, rare freeze events in the Panhandle, combined with aging pipe materials in older Broadview Park homes, makes pipe failures a consistent concern across Broward County. Pipes in exterior walls, attics, crawlspaces, and garages are most vulnerable. Call (888) 766-7573 immediately โ every minute water flows increases structural damage and mold risk.
- Clogged and slow drains โ Kitchen grease, bathroom hair and soap buildup, and tree root intrusion in outdoor sewer lines are the most frequent causes of drain problems in Broadview Park. Professional hydro-jetting clears blockages that store-bought chemicals cannot reach.
- Water heater failure โ Most Broadview Park water heaters last 8โ12 years before very hard โ high calcium from limestone aquifers statewide scale buildup, heating element failure, or tank corrosion forces replacement. Warning signs include lukewarm water, rust-colored output, popping sounds during heating, and water pooling around the unit base.
- Sewer line blockages โ Tree root intrusion in clay and cast iron sewer laterals causes the most significant drain backups in Broward County. Signs include multiple fixtures backing up simultaneously, sewage odor indoors, and gurgling sounds from toilets when other drains run.
- Hidden water leaks โ Unexplained water bill spikes, damp patches on walls or ceilings, the sound of running water when everything is off, or unexpected mold growth are key indicators of a hidden leak requiring professional acoustic or thermal detection.
- Toilet problems โ Running toilets waste up to 200 gallons per day and are among the most frequent calls in Broadview Park. Our plumbers handle flapper and fill valve replacement, complete toilet installation, wax ring repair, and stubborn clogs that won't respond to a plunger.
- Low water pressure โ Sudden pressure loss throughout your Broadview Park home typically indicates a main supply line issue, a failing pressure regulating valve, or mineral scale accumulation in older galvanized pipes.

Drain Cleaning in Broadview Park, FL
Some Broadview Park homeowners treat drain cleaning as something you do when there's a problem. Others in Broward County treat it as a scheduled maintenance item โ running a main line cleaning every year or two regardless of symptoms, clearing buildup before it produces a backup at an inconvenient time. Which approach makes sense depends on the specific home: newer sewer lines without tree coverage may not need scheduled cleaning. Older lines with significant tree canopy overhead, or homes where prior root intrusion has been documented, benefit meaningfully from regular preventive clearing. We help homeowners decide which category their property fits rather than recommending the same schedule for every situation.
Signs you need professional drain cleaning in Broadview Park:
- Drain stays slow after using a plunger or store-bought cleaner
- The same drain clogs repeatedly every few weeks
- Multiple drains running slowly at the same time
- Gurgling sounds from drains or toilets when not in use
- Sewage smell from drains or the yard
- Toilets bubbling when the bathtub or sink drains

Commercial water heating in Broadview Park โ laundromats, hotels, restaurants, medical facilities, and multi-unit residential properties โ operates at a scale where conventional residential approaches don't apply. High-capacity storage tanks require scheduled maintenance, anode rod service, and sediment management at intervals that residential maintenance schedules don't match. Booster heaters for commercial dishwashing systems have specific temperature requirements (typically 180ยฐF at the final rinse) that must be maintained for health department compliance. Sewer Line Cleaning & Repair in Broadview Park, FL
When sewer line problems strike a Broadview Park property, our licensed plumbers begin with a waterproof video camera inspection โ sending a high-definition camera through the line to identify the exact problem before any digging begins. This approach protects you from unnecessary excavation and ensures the correct repair is performed the first time. Where conditions allow, trenchless pipe lining and pipe bursting methods rehabilitate or replace sewer lines with minimal disruption to your yard and landscaping.

- Know your main shutoff location โ Before any emergency occurs, locate your main water shutoff valve and ensure every adult in the household knows how to operate it quickly. This single step can prevent thousands of dollars in water damage when a pipe fails unexpectedly.
- Act on early warning signs โ Slow drains, low water pressure, discolored water, and unexpectedly high water bills are early indicators of developing problems. Addressing them early is almost always less expensive than waiting for a failure.
- Schedule annual water heater maintenance โ Flushing sediment, inspecting the anode rod, and testing the pressure relief valve annually can add 3โ5 years to your water heater's service life and prevent the most common failure modes.
- Inspect outdoor plumbing seasonally โ Florida's subtropical heat, hurricane season, rare freeze events in the Panhandle creates specific stress points for outdoor hose bibs, exposed pipe runs, and irrigation systems. A brief seasonal inspection prevents the most common weather-related plumbing failures in Broadview Park homes.
